Energy consumption model in multicore architectures with variable frequency

被引:4
|
作者
Meneses-Viveros, Amilcar [1 ]
Paredes-Lopez, Mireya [2 ]
Hernandez-Rubio, Erika [3 ]
Gitler, Isidoro [4 ]
机构
[1] Ctr Res & Adv Studies, Dept Comp Sci, Mexico City, DF, Mexico
[2] Univ Americas Puebla, Cholula, Mexico
[3] Inst Politecn Nacl, SEPI ESCOM, Mexico City, DF, Mexico
[4] Ctr Res & Adv Studies, Dept Math, Mexico City, DF, Mexico
来源
JOURNAL OF SUPERCOMPUTING | 2021年 / 77卷 / 03期
关键词
Amdahl's law; Energy model; Multicore processors; Parallel programs; Turbo Boost; Variable frequency; EXTENDING AMDAHLS LAW; AMD;
D O I
10.1007/s11227-020-03349-0
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Models extending Amdahl's law have been developed to study the behavior of parallel programs energy consumption. In addition, it has been shown that energy consumption of those programs also relies on the layout of the resources on the chip, such as power supply. Other extensions over Amdahl's law have been conducted to study the behavior of parallel programs speedup for frequency variable processors. Previous models have focused on the use of Turbo Boost in the parallel regions of a program, without considering that Turbo Boost also affects the sequential regions. Hence, we present a model to analyze energy consumption of parallel programs executed on Intel multicore processors with Turbo Boost frequencies to cover this gap. The model is an extension to Amdahl's law, and it is validated with a double-precision matrix multiplication running on Intel multicore processors that enable Turbo Boost technology.
引用
收藏
页码:2458 / 2485
页数:28
相关论文
共 50 条
  • [1] Energy consumption model in multicore architectures with variable frequency
    Amilcar Meneses-Viveros
    Mireya Paredes-López
    Erika Hernández-Rubio
    Isidoro Gitler
    The Journal of Supercomputing, 2021, 77 : 2458 - 2485
  • [2] Energy consumption model over parallel programs implemented on multicore architectures
    Isidro-Ramirez, Ricardo
    Meneses Viveros, Amilcar
    Hernandez Rubio, Erika
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2015, 6 (06) : 252 - 259
  • [3] A framework for monitoring energy consumption in multicore architectures
    Pinto, Bruno Giacobo
    de Souza Xavier, Lucas Mendonca
    Favaretto, Rodolfo Migon
    Homrich Cavalheiro, Gerson Geraldo
    REVISTA BRASILEIRA DE COMPUTACAO APLICADA, 2015, 7 (03): : 108 - 119
  • [4] On the Performance and Energy Efficiency of the PGAS Programming Model on Multicore Architectures
    Lagraviere, Jeremie
    Langguth, Johannes
    Sourouri, Mohammed
    Ha, Phuong H.
    Cai, Xing
    2016 INTERNATIONAL CONFERENCE ON HIGH PERFORMANCE COMPUTING & SIMULATION (HPCS 2016), 2016, : 800 - 807
  • [5] Global Adaptation for Energy Efficiency in Multicore Architectures
    Lenz, Alina
    Pieper, Tobias
    Obermaisser, Roman
    2017 25TH EUROMICRO INTERNATIONAL CONFERENCE ON PARALLEL, DISTRIBUTED AND NETWORK-BASED PROCESSING (PDP 2017), 2017, : 551 - 558
  • [6] Dynamic Voltage and Frequency Scaling Optimization for Multicore Architectures
    Chien, Ting-Hsuan
    Chang, Rong-Guey
    INTELLIGENT SYSTEMS AND APPLICATIONS (ICS 2014), 2015, 274 : 298 - 307
  • [7] Power Consumption of Parallel Programming Interfaces in Multicore Architectures: A Case Study
    Garcia, Adriano Marques
    Schepke, Claudio
    Girardi, Alessandro Goncalves
    da Silva, Sherlon Almeida
    2018 SYMPOSIUM ON HIGH PERFORMANCE COMPUTING SYSTEMS (WSCAD 2018), 2018, : 77 - 83
  • [8] Comparison sorting on hybrid multicore architectures for fixed and variable length keys
    Banerjee, Dip Sankar
    Sakurikar, Parikshit
    Kothapalli, Kishore
    INTERNATIONAL JOURNAL OF HIGH PERFORMANCE COMPUTING APPLICATIONS, 2014, 28 (03): : 267 - 284
  • [9] Instructions energy consumption on a heterogeneous multicore platform
    Krunic, Momcilo
    Kovacevic, Jelena
    Popovic, Miroslav
    Krunic, Vlado
    PROCEEDINGS OF THE FIFTH EUROPEAN CONFERENCE ON THE ENGINEERING OF COMPUTER-BASED SYSTEMS (ECBS 2017), 2017,
  • [10] Roofline: An Insightful Visual Performance Model for Multicore Architectures
    Williams, Samuel
    Waterman, Andrew
    Patterson, David
    COMMUNICATIONS OF THE ACM, 2009, 52 (04) : 65 - 76